Museum Work


Museum work relates to the conservation and maintenance of ancient and antique items including the old historical pieces and work of art. The professional belonging to the museum work profession play an important part in the preservation of these exquisite, unique objects of historical discipline for the prospective generations.

The museum professionals are responsible for performing different roles based on their job profiles. They are involved in the attainment, presentation, and classification of objects of art work including instruments, documents, and other pieces. They may even prepare planning and organizing methods for the display of presentations and demonstrations from other museums or artists in a particular museum.

They have an opportunity to get employed in a historical location, zoo, botanical parks, aquariums or nature centers. They are mainly active in working with objects that possess natural, historical, and ethnic importance. They are also involved in categorization and authorization of art pieces as well as the arrangement of demonstrations.

One of the major roles they play is of the publicity, promotion, and fund raising for certain set of collections or peculiar museum organizations. They do this by visiting civic and convention seminars or meetings including setting up of publicity substantials and economic aid proposals.

Advancement of Museum Work

Educational scholarships, leadership abilities, and business insightful attitude are all the attributes essential for museum professionals who are looking for an advancement in museum vocation.

Advancement probabilities are scarce in small scale museum, however in large scale museums these professional can expect diverse promotional opportunities, one of them being the position of museum director. Museum professionals need to possess their museum work in peer-reviewed journals and a Ph. D. degree in order to reach that position.

Job Prospects of Museum Work

The average salary for museum work professionals is $46,000 approximately according to the current updates. Those candidates with internships and proper theoretical education can look for a good job outlook in this field as many employers prefer hiring experienced applicants.

By the next decade, employment odds of museum work is expected to increase by twenty percent.
